    Jamie M.

    Super cute place to enjoy a sandwich. I've been here a few times and gotten the Sod buster vegetarian sandwich. It's pretty good and comes with a small bag of chips. It's about $8 iirc so I kind of wish for that price it would come with a drink but it doesn't. There is plenty of seating outside in the cute silos and plenty of parking. You can also drive thru. They are closed on Sundays. The service staff is nice and the menu has some good variety if you're there for breakfast. They also have clean restrooms if you are stopping for lunch on a road trip.

    Yoon H.

    Pit stop at a quaint little coffee shop about 2 miles off main freeway in Cedar City. Clean and inviting atmosphere. Very lovely outdoor dining option. Front register person was friendly, but seemed very busy managing all the tasks required of her; therefore, I didn't ask any questions I wanted to about the menu being a first time customer. Ordered a White Praline latte, straight black coffee, breakfast wrap, sodbuster sandwich. Surprisingly impressed with the latte, it was very tasteful for a coffee snob. Breakfast wrap and sandwich were both flavorful. Veggies in sodbuster sandwich were fresh. Prices were reasonable and fair. Overall very fast service with it being an apparent busy morning. Would return for a future visit.
